    For the academic year 2023-2024, the undergraduate tuition & fees at Ithaca College is $50,510. The 2024 undergraduate tuition has been risen by 4.63% compared to the previous year. Its undergraduate tuition & fees is much higher than the average amount for similar schools' tuition of $35,287. The 2025 estimated undergraduate tuition & fees is $52,...

    For graduate programs, 2024 tuition & fees is $28,601. The graduate tuition has been risen by 13.15% compared to the previous year. Its graduate tuition & fees is much higher than the average amount for similar schools' tuition of $17,742. The estimated graduate school tuition & fees is $32,361 for the academic year 2024-2025 , a 13.1% increase com...

    The below table describes the cost per credit hour for part-time students and/or full-time students who take additional courses more than regular credit hours at Ithaca. The undergraduate cost per credit hour is $1,679. The graduate tuition per credit hour is $1,185.

    The living costs including for room, board, transpiration, and other personal expenses is $17,356. The Living costs increased by 1.44% compared to the previous year for both on-campus and off-campus stay. The Ithaca's 2024 on-campus COA is $68,716 and off-campus COA is $68,716.

  4. Nov 21, 2022 · For returning full-time undergraduates residing on campus, the total direct cost of attendance will be $65,910, an increase of 2.89%. The breakdown is as follows: Tuition $49,880 (3.65%) Room $9,160 (1%) Board $6,870 (0%) Public Health Fee eliminated.

To put these costs into perspective, the average total annual costs of studying in the United States are as follows: 15,862 USD for public two-year colleges, 25,707 USD for in-state students at a four-year public college, 44,014 USD for out-of-state students at a four-year public college, and 54,501 USD for private non-profit four-year colleges.
